Personal & Financial Insights

Every occupation has a unique profile. For Architectural and Civil Drafters, the Bureau of Labor Statistics and O*NET classify the day-to-day work broadly as: Prepare detailed drawings of architectural and structural features of buildings or drawings and topographical relief maps used in civil engineering projects, such as highways, bridges, and public works. Use knowledge of building materials, engineering practices, and mathematics to complete drawings.

Avg. Annual Salary $68,860
Avg. Hourly Wage $33.11
Available Jobs (US) 109,550
Job Title & Hierarchy Code (SOC) Architectural and Civil Drafters #17-3011

Core Skills & Abilities

  • Prepare colored drawings of landscape and interior designs for presentation to client.

  • Calculate weights, volumes, and stress factors and their implications for technical aspects of designs.

  • Represent architect or engineer on construction site, ensuring builder compliance with design specifications and advising on design corrections, under supervision.

  • Determine the order of work and method of presentation, such as orthographic or isometric drawing.

  • Supervise and train other technologists, technicians, and drafters.

  • Obtain and assemble data to complete architectural designs, visiting job sites to compile measurements as necessary.

  • Calculate heat loss and gain of buildings and structures to determine required equipment specifications, following standard procedures.

  • Prepare cost estimates, contracts, bidding documents, and technical reports for specific projects under an architect's or engineer's supervision.

  • Draw rough and detailed scale plans for foundations, buildings, and structures, based on preliminary concepts, sketches, engineering calculations, specification sheets, and other data.

  • Coordinate structural, electrical, and mechanical designs and determine a method of presentation to graphically represent building plans.

  • Locate and identify symbols on topographical surveys to denote geological and geophysical formations or oil field installations.

  • Reproduce drawings on copy machines or trace copies of plans and drawings, using transparent paper or cloth, ink, pencil, and standard drafting instruments.

  • Plot characteristics of boreholes for oil and gas wells from photographic subsurface survey recordings and other data, representing depth, degree, and direction of inclination.

  • Check dimensions of materials to be used and assign numbers to lists of materials.

  • Explain drawings to production or construction teams and provide adjustments as necessary.

  • Analyze building codes, by-laws, space and site requirements, and other technical documents and reports to determine their effect on architectural designs.

  • Calculate excavation tonnage and prepare graphs and fill-hauling diagrams for use in earth-moving operations.

  • Produce drawings, using computer-assisted drafting systems (CAD) or drafting machines, or by hand, using compasses, dividers, protractors, triangles, and other drafting devices.

  • Determine quality, cost, strength, and quantity of required materials, and enter figures on materials lists.

  • Correlate, interpret, and modify data obtained from topographical surveys, well logs, and geophysical prospecting reports.

  • Supervise or conduct field surveys, inspections, or technical investigations to obtain data required to revise construction drawings.

  • Draft plans and detailed drawings for structures, installations, and construction projects, such as highways, sewage disposal systems, and dikes, working from sketches or notes.

  • Draw maps, diagrams, and profiles, using cross-sections and surveys, to represent elevations, topographical contours, subsurface formations, and structures.

  • Determine procedures and instructions to be followed, according to design specifications and quantity of required materials.

  • Create freehand drawings and lettering to accompany drawings.

  • Finish and duplicate drawings and documentation packages according to required mediums and specifications for reproduction, using blueprinting, photography, or other duplicating methods.

  • Lay out and plan interior room arrangements for commercial buildings, using computer-assisted drafting (CAD) equipment and software.

  • Review rough sketches, drawings, specifications, and other engineering data to ensure that they conform to design concepts.
